Top 5 Real-Time Strategy iOS Apps in Africa Q4 2023
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 real-time strategy games on the iOS platform in Africa during Q4 2023, featuring download, revenue, and active user data.
In the fourth quarter of 2023, the performance of the top five real-time strategy games on iOS in Africa revealed intriguing tr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here's a detailed look at how these games fared:
Clash Royale from Supercell experienced notable fluctuations in its weekly revenue, peaking at around $6.8K in early October and again at $6.7K in early November. Weekly downloads showed a consistent upward trend, culminating in approximately 2.2K by the end of December. Active users also saw a steady increase, reaching about 48.3K in the final week of the quarter.
Warcraft Rumble by Blizzard Entertainment, a newcomer released in early November, saw its highest weekly revenue at the beginning of November with nearly $1.9K. However, revenue gradually decreased to around $755 by the end of December. Downloads followed a similar pattern, starting strong with 2.9K in late October and tapering off to 184 by the end of the quarter. Active users decreased from 2.3K to around 852 over the same period.
Mob Control from Voodoo experienced a relatively steady revenue stream, with weekly earnings hovering around $500 to $600. The game saw a spike in downloads in late December, reaching up to 983. Active users showed a gradual increase, with a notable peak at approximately 1.8K in the final week.
Art of War: Legions by Fastone Games had modest revenue, peaking at $837 in late September and stabilizing around $260 to $324 toward the end of the year. Downloads remained low, with a maximum of 23 in late October. Active users hovered around 130 to 180 throughout the quarter.
Art Of War 3:RTS Strategy Game from GEAR GAMES GLOBAL FZE saw its highest weekly revenue in late October at $714, with fluctuations leading to a notable peak of $578 in the last week of December. Downloads remained relatively stable, with minor peaks around 98 in late November. Active users showed a gradual increase, peaking at 136 in late November.
